An Introduction to “Health in Her Hue”

Healthcare discrimination and bias have been persistent issues for non-white populations, resulting in a gap in health outcomes and even death. Research studies have established that people of color had worse health outcomes than white counterparts, partly due to marginalization, limited access to care, and the lack of cultural understanding in the medical arena. The importance of acknowledging and validating the diverse health experiences of women of color motivated the creation of “Health in Her Hue.”

Understanding “Health in Her Hue”

“Health in Her Hue” is an initiative by Black women founded to create a space and resources for communities of color to receive culturally informed health care without fear of bias and stigmatization. The platform aims to bridge the health disparities that continue to prevent women of color from achieving well-rounded health outcomes. “Health in Her Hue” also serves as an expert resource for health professionals to gain knowledge and skill-building tools to address the unique, complex, and intersectional health needs of women of color.

Efforts being made by the “Health in Her Hue” initiative.

The “Health in Her Hue” initiative strives to make health accessible and equitable for all women of color through various efforts, including:

  • Providing resources regarding trusted healthcare professionals in the women of color population.
  • Offering workshops and forums that discuss the interconnectivity of various health needs.
  • Networking and advertising for health professionals of color to promote better representation and cultural understanding.
  • Partnering with organizations that center around women of color’s needs, including maternal care, reproductive wellness, and mental health.
  • Maintaining an online community to share stories and experiences for emotional support, medical advice, and validation of health experiences.
